Plexiglas® Acrylic Sheet Family
Plexiglas® acrylic sheet has been considered the standard of the industry since it was first introduced 75 years ago because of its unsurpassed quality,
ease of use, and wide range of colors, patterns, thicknesses, and sizes.
Since its introduction, the Plexiglas® family has continued to expand and now includes Plexiglas® G, MC, Q, T, UF and Frosted acrylic sheet formulations.

| Plexiglas® G |
Premium, architectural grade, cell cast. Best optical quality, highest resistance to chemicals and long-term design stress, superior weatherability. |

| Plexiglas® Frosted |
Unique textured surface diffuses light to create dramatic effects. Ideal for retail merchandising or lighting applications. Frosted look engineered throughout the entire acrylic structure. |

| Plexiglas® Clear-Edge Frosted |
Sheet consists of a middle clear acrylic layer sandwiched between thin top and bottom frosted layers. Ideal choice for designers looking to create attractive lighting, shelving, tabletop and POP displays. One sided formulation also available. |

| Plexiglas® T |
The beauty of Plexiglas® MC with added impact resistance – seven times tougher than standard acrylic sheet. |

| Plexiglas® T2 |
Used in displays where additional durability is needed. 17 times tougher than standard acrylic sheet. |

| Plexiglas® T3 |
Greatest level of impact resistance. 22 times tougher than standard acrylic sheet. |

| Plexiglas® Q |
Excellent choice for retail, cosmetic countertop and point of purchase displays. Enhanced craze resistance and durability. |

| Plexiglas® SQ |
Primarily for sign market, made by melt calendering process. Exceptional surface finish and clarity with enhanced craze resistance. |

| Plexiglas® SG |
Continuous process sheet, exceptional clarity, eight times the impact of standard acrylic sheet – plus outstanding thermoforming definition. |

| Plexiglas ® SB |
Bullet-resistant for use in banks, secure facilities and vandal-prone locations. |
